About Hendricks Behavioral Hospital

Hendricks Behavioral Hospital does not carry an overall CMS Hospital Compare star rating — typically because the hospital is too small, too specialized, or reports too few of the underlying measures to compute the composite. The CMS Hospital Compare measures break roughly evenly between better- and worse-than-benchmark performance, which is the modal pattern across U.S. hospitals.

Cost-wise, Hendricks Behavioral Hospital is mid-pack: $13,863 average payment across documented procedures, close to the median for U.S. acute-care facilities. The combined value score — quality versus cost — works out to 60/100, an above-average showing.

Hendricks Behavioral Hospital is investor-owned — a proprietary hospital, the minority ownership pattern in U.S. acute care. For-profit hospitals are more concentrated in some regions (Florida, Texas, Nevada) than others. The CMS payment record for Hendricks Behavioral Hospital lists 14 distinct DRG codes — a mid-range procedure mix, including Esophagitis, Gastroenteritis with MCC, Nutritional and Misc Metabolic Disorders with MCC, Major Hip and Knee Joint Replacement. Emergency services are not offered, which is unusual for an acute-care facility — most often reflects a specialty hospital or non-traditional inpatient model.

How Hendricks Behavioral Hospital Compares

Hendricks Behavioral Hospital has an average Medicare payment of $13,863, 1% below the Indiana state average of $13,977. That is 13% lower than the national hospital average of $15,878. Most of its procedures fall under Digestive, where the typical payment is $13,376 (4% above this hospital's average). Its Value Score of C (60/100) reflects a blend of price percentile, CMS quality rating, and patient outcome measures.
